The Telfair Museum of Art in Savannah is actually three museums in one, keeping its holdings in a trio of buildings, two of which are National Historic Landmarks. With one admission payment, you get access to all three – and there is no need to rush because your admission gives you a week to visit all three locations: Telfair Academy (121 Barnard Street), Owens-Thomas House (124 Abercorn Street), Jepson Center (207 W. York Street)
